Mimiko Resigns PDP Membership, Might Join LP Today by Ebullience(m): 6:27pm On Jun 13, 2018
Former Governor of Ondo State, Dr Olusegun Mimiko, on Wednesday, resigned his membership from the opposition Peoples Democratic Party (PDP).

The letter which was personally signed by the former governor and addressed to the leadership of the party in the state, stating his intention to resign his membership from the party.

The read “I hereby with utmost humility inform you of my decision to resign my membership of the PDP with effect from today, June 13, 2018, for some well-thought-out personal reasons.

“It was an honour working the many prominent Nigerians with whom I shared the PDP platform for the entire period I was in there as a member. Accept please the assurance of my very high regards.”

However, Nigerian Tribune gathered that the former governor and his followers from PDP will today (Thursday) rejoin the Labour Party.

Mimiko, who was governor of the state for two terms of eight years will be returning to the party after some four years of collapsing the structure of the LP to the PDP ahead of the 2015 general elections.

Mimiko has been keeping mute over the development as there have been speculations on his defection in the last couple of months

One of the aides of the former governor, however, confirmed that the official declaration of Mimiko and his followers will hold at the Ondo Civic Centre in Ondo town on today, Thursday.

According to him, Mimiko will register as a member of an LP in his ward tomorrow before moving to the civic centre for an official declaration.

He said, “The official declaration of Mimiko and his followers will hold at the Ondo Civic Centre in Ondo town on Thursday, and this will signal the rebuilding of the structure of the LP which was collapsed into the PDP in 2014.”

Speaking on Mimiko’s defection, the Chairman of the PDP in the state, Chief Clement Faboyede, said Mimiko’s defection would not affect the fortune of the party in the state.

Faboyede who expressed surprise at the news of former governor and leader of the party in the state said “the PDP is a very big party that can be likened to an orange tree and if you pluck from it, it does not kill the orange. Therefore the party will survive.

“Dr Mimiko is one of the big fish that left the PDP before and the party is still striving now, we will just hope all these are rumour and that it will not come to happen.

“We really love Dr Mimiko and always want to be part of his political planning. We are hoping he will not leave, and if he does, the party (PDP) will survive.

Mimiko informed us of his intention and we feel he is entitled to his own opinion and calculations and he hinged his defection on what he said was his belief and can no longer stay in PDP

He has communicated that he is going to consult, and he gathered and talk to every stratum of party members and gave reasons, while some agreed and some did not agree and we tried at our own level to discourage him but he has picked a date.

“I believe he is a member of the party until he leaves and If he leaves, good luck to him and goodbye to him. If he eventually leaves, PDP will not and will never die”

Mimiko and his supporters left the LP on October 2, 2014, to collapse the LP structure in the state into the PDP ahead of 2015 election.
